One shot in South Bakersfield on Monitor Street

Police were called to the scene of a shooting on Monitor Street Friday afternoon.

The call came in about 1:42 p.m. regarding one person who was shot. Officers arrived in the 4600 block Monitor and found an adult man suffering from multiple gunshot wounds.

The victim was transported to a local hospital with moderate injuries. Two subjects were seen running from the area immediately after the shooting and officials are asking for anyone with information to contact police. 

Officials said two people were seen running from the area immediately after the shooting. Police describe them as:

Subject #1: Hispanic male, mid-teens, heavy build, wearing white T-shirt, blue jeans 

Subject #2: Hispanic male, mid-teens, thin build, wearing white T-shirt, blue jeans

One resident who lives in the area told 23ABC a male victim was shot three times, being struck in the back, lower body, and buttocks. The resident said she knows the victim and he is expected to survive.

Students traveling through the area going home from school have to detour around the crime scene.

Officials are asking anyone with information to contact BPD at 327-7111.
